Wedmont Private Capital Trims Stake in H&R Block, Inc. (NYSE:HRB)

Wedmont Private Capital reduced its holdings in shares of H&R Block, Inc. (NYSE:HRBFree Report) by 33.0% in the first quarter, according to the company in its most recent disclosure with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The fund owned 8,290 shares of the company’s stock after selling 4,081 shares during the period. Wedmont Private Capital’s holdings in H&R Block were worth $388,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

H&R Block Trading Up 0.3 %

HRB opened at $53.15 on Friday. H&R Block, Inc. has a 1-year low of $30.66 and a 1-year high of $54.21. The stock has a market capitalization of $7.42 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 12.16, a P/E/G ratio of 0.99 and a beta of 0.69. The business has a 50 day moving average of $50.05 and a 200-day moving average of $48.30.

H&R Block (NYSE:HRBGet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Thursday, May 9th. The company reported $4.94 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$4.66 by $0.28. H&R Block had a negative return on equity of 224.81% and a net margin of 17.87%. The company had revenue of $2.18 billion during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$2.14 billion. During the same period in the previous year, the company earned $4.20 EPS. The company’s revenue for the quarter was up 4.4% compared to the same quarter last year. Equities analysts predict that H&R Block, Inc. will post 4.29 EPS for the current year.

H&R Block Dividend Announcement

The business also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Wednesday, July 3rd. Stockholders of record on Wednesday, June 5th will be issued a dividend of $0.32 per share. This represents a $1.28 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 2.41%. The ex-dividend date is Wednesday, June 5th. H&R Block’s dividend payout ratio (DPR) is currently 29.29%.

H&R Block Company Profile

H&R Block, Inc, through its subsidiaries, provides assisted income tax return preparation and do-it-yourself (DIY) tax return preparation services and products to the general public primarily in the United States, Canada, and Australia. It offers assisted income tax return preparation and related services through a system of retail offices operated directly by the company or its franchisees.
